Easy & Simple Soy Sauce Eggs

Soft-boiled eggs marinated in a savory umami broth with a hint of Chinese five spice. These quick and easy soy sauce eggs are made with simple ingredients! A great snack, main, side dish or appetizer with your meal!

Ingredients

  • 3 large eggs room temperature (see Expert Tips in blog post to bring cold eggs to room temp.)
Marinade
  • 6 tablespoon Regular soy sauce
  • 2 cups water cold
  • ½ teaspoon Chinese five spice
  • 1 tablespoon white granulated sugar
  • ½ tablespoon rice vinegar or apple cider vinegar or white vinegar

Instructions

    Cup of Yum
  1. Bring a small pot of water to boil on medium-high heat. Gently lower room temperature eggs into the boiling water. Reduce to medium heat for a rolling boil. Set a timer and boil for 6:30 minutes. For hard boiled eggs, boil for 11 minutes.
  2. Prepare an ice bath for your eggs. Once the eggs are cooked, remove and transfer to ice bath to stop the cooking process.
  3. Carefully crack and peel your eggs with the back of a spoon. Place them into a small deep container or mason jar.
  4. In a small bowl, whisk together the marinade ingredients in a small pot. Bring it to boil on medium-high heat and then simmer on low heat for 5 minutes uncovered. Remove the broth off heat to cool down completely.
  5. Pour the room temperature marinade over the eggs.
  6. Cover and seal the container. Store in the fridge to marinate for at least 6 hours or overnight for best flavour. When ready to enjoy, remove as many eggs as desired and slice into half with a sharp knife to enjoy chilled.
